F1Technical.net: Massa ties the knot (Powered by TotalF1.com) Former Champ: Schu could return to racing Saturday 1st December 2007 ![]() Former F1 Champion Alan Jones reckons Michael Schumacher may be considering a comeback after an impressive test at Barcelona two week's ago. Although Schumacher retired from F1 at the end of the 2006 season, the German returned to action with Ferrari at the Spanish track in the first of the winter tests. The seven-time World Champion proved to be the man to beat as he dominated the timesheets during his two days of testing. And although Schumacher has stated many times that his test does not mean he will be making a competitive comeback, Jones reckons the thought has to have crossed Schumi's mind. "After nearly a year out of the saddle, I can image him thinking, 'Maybe I'd like to have another go.' It must be just like coming back from an extended Christmas break," Jones told Autosport. "He used to take a couple of months off at the end of each season, so another few months won't make a big difference. Two or three years might have done. "It's a win-win situation: Ferrari gains from his expertise and he enjoys it. And you can never rule out a comeback - he might be thinking, 'I'm really enjoying this!' Money won't be his motivation, it will be to prove a point. "Niki Lauda was out for several seasons and came back and won the title. Michael could do the same." Schumacher misses Massa's wedding day Dec.3 (GMM) A representative for Michael Schumacher has played down speculation that he may have fallen out with his former Ferrari teammate Felipe Massa. In the presence of many of his Ferrari colleagues, 26-year-old married his fiancee Rafaela Bassi, who is 27, in Sao Paulo last Friday, according to reports from Brazil and Italy. Among the 800 guests were team bosses Jean Todt and Stefano Domenicali, as well as Mario Almondo, Aldo Costa and Luca Baldisserri -- but not Schumacher, his 2006 teammate. Massa's countryman Rubens Barrichello also attended, reports said. Days earlier, the former seven time world champion, Schumacher, won a karting event hosted by Massa in the southern Brazilian city of Florianopolis. The German newspaper Bild am Sonntag said Schumacher had celebrated Massa's impending marriage with his former teammate and friend in the days prior. A representative for Schumacher said: "Michael is currently in the United States for a family vacation." |

Williams Formula-1 News and Updates Posted: 18 Nov 2013 09:53 PM PST Team tips Nakajima to impress in '09 Sunday, 09 November 2008 10:23 Williams' chief operations engineer Rod Nelson thinks Kazuki Nakajima will take a big leap forward next season now that he has got his rookie year out of the way. The young Japanese driver had a quietly impressive first full year of Formula 1, shaking off the wild reputation he had earned in the junior categories and delivering five points finishes. Nakajima also steadily closed the gap to his highly-rated team-mate Nico Rosberg, eventually out-qualifying the rapid German on four occasions. Team tips Nakajima to impress in '09 - F1 | ITV Sport |
Red Bull Racing News and Updates Posted: 18 Nov 2013 09:45 PM PST RBR signs Vettel for 2009 Thursday, 17 July 2008 13:21 Red Bull Racing has confirmed that it has signed Sebastian Vettel to partner Mark Webber in its 2009 driver line-up. A vacancy opened up at the Milton Keynes-based squad following David Coulthard's decision to retire at the end of this season, and Vettel has been widely tipped for promotion from Red Bull's 'B' team Toro Rosso. However there has also been speculation that RBR was trying to entice double world champion Fernando Alonso away from Renault, but the Spaniard remains non-committal about his plans for next year and has been linked to a move to Ferrari in 2010. Team principal Christian Horner said he was confident that, despite Vettel's youth and relative inexperience, the 21-year-old German was the right choice. "We are delighted that Sebastian will be joining us next year," said Horner. "With David Coulthard announcing his retirement as a Formula 1 driver a fortnight ago at the British Grand Prix, after careful consideration, it seemed natural to announce his replacement here at Sebastian's home race in Hockenheim. "As he was already part of the Red Bull family, choosing Sebastian as Mark Webber's team-mate was not a difficult decision. RBR signs Vettel for 2009 - F1 | ITV Sport |

Opera Browser and Opera Mail are now two separate apps Posted: 18 Nov 2013 11:39 AM PST It has been more than two months since the release of last preview from the Opera Stable. And the latest preview seems to be more aimed at making the first view of the opera browser more simple for new users. User Interface has been thoroughly redesigned yet again with fewer options on the front end. Complicated settings have been moved to deeper levels of options. Some of the most noticeable features are close button on the tabs, a popup blocker notifier. Popup blocking is enabled by default now on fresh installs. There is a new recycle bin button, which lists the blocked popups and closed tabs, giving easy accessibility. And M2 (Opera Mail Client) users will like the updated auto-resizing reply box in the mails. Another interesting feature are the security icon (padlock) and RSS icon that comes in the address bar itself when on a secure page or a page correctly linked to a valid RSS newsfeed. For more information, the Changelog is located here. Users can download the new beta from the Opera Forums Post.
